fix(portal): pre-merge security hardening from code review
- PORTAL_OPEN_LINKS now defaults OFF — /portal/open/* is an unauthenticated, proxy-reachable session-minting path (and a linked project's open link grants the whole client's scope), so it must be explicitly enabled in dev. - Session cookie: enforce server-side expiry (check iat vs COOKIE_MAX_AGE — was browser-only) and guard a non-dict signed body (was an uncaught AttributeError → 500, reachable if SECRET_KEY is the insecure default). - Escape operator-set strings (location/rule/event names) before innerHTML + Leaflet tooltips — they're client-facing, so a name with markup was stored XSS in the client's browser. Global esc() helper applied at every injection point. - WS _scrub_frame drops a non-JSON frame instead of forwarding it raw; /history rows now whitelisted like the other scoped endpoints. - Preview-client slug uses the full project id (an 8-char prefix could collide two projects onto one client). Verified: cookie reader (fresh/expired/non-dict/missing-iat) + open-links default off; templates parse; scoped scrubbing intact.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.8 <noreply@anthropic.com>
